High Gain Stacked DipoleArray

Design Features: The SD3-75 high performance VHF stacked dipole array is designed for use with highly populated radio sites requiring long haul omni-directional coverage. The SD3-75 is heavy duty stacked dipole array features, wide bandwidth, high gain, high power handling capacity, low VSWR, low noise performance and null filling coverage with omni directional characteristics. This stacked dipole array is highly suitable as base station antennas for Repeater and Paging sites.
Constructions: The SD3-75 Stacked Dipole Array consists of two folded dipoles stacked vertically, fed in phase. This Stacked Dipole Antenna operates at D.C. ground for protection against lightning. Termination of phasing harness cable sealed by heat shrinking tube making stacked dipole antenna waterproofing. The 6 Meters long central mast for mounting the dipoles is shipped in two sections of 3 Meters each for easy of shipping. The stacked dipole antenna is suitable for side mounting on the tower and is supplied with mounting hardware of 1.35 Meters (4.5 feet) long two horizontal arms to hold the antenna on the side of the antenna tower.
Radiation Pattern: When the TWO dipoles are arranged 180 degrees apart around the central mast, 3dBd. omni directional radiation pattern results. Aligning the TWO dipoles collinearly (facing in one direction) a 6dBd. offset radiation pattern is obtained. The radiation pattern can be changed in the field by use of common hand tools..

Electrical Specifications:
Frequency Range 66 - 88 MHz
Gain 3 dBd.
Bandwidth 6 MHz.
Polarization Vertical
Input Impedance 50 Ohms
Radiation Pattern Omni-directional
VSWR - Equal To or Better Then 1:1.5
RF Power Handling Capacity 500 Watts
Input Termination N-Female
Lightning Protection Direct Ground

Mechanical Specifications:
Antenna Materials All Aluminum
Mounting Hardware -Materials Stainless Steel
Wind Rating 200 Km/Hr
Overall Length 6 Meters
Shipping Length 3 Meters
Maximum Mount Pipe Diameter 51 mm (2 Inches)
Support Pipe (Mast) - Material Aluminum 51 mm OD
Gross Weight 20 Kgs.

Environmental Specifications:
Operating Temperature (-)30 to +70 Degrees Celsius
Storage Temperature (-)40 to +80 Degrees Celsius
Humidity 0 to 95% RH
